A 2024 Congressional report disclosed that there were 617 retired Members of Congress earning a pension based on their congressional service as of October 1, 2024. 318 of the 617 retired Congressmen covered by the CSRS plan earned an average annual pension of $75,528. WebMar 14, 2024 · Congressional pensions are financed through both employee and employer contributions. All members today pay Social Security taxes equal to 6.2% of the taxable wage base of $132,900. They also contribute to the Civil Service Retirement and Disability Fund, with payments ranging from 3.1-4.4% of their pay depending upon their pension …
